Early Life and Background
Milton Supman, better known as Soupy Sales, was born on January 8, 1926, in Franklinton, North Carolina. Growing up in a modest family, he developed a keen interest in entertainment from a young age. His comedic talents were evident early on, and he quickly became a local favorite in school performances and community events.
Soupy's early years were marked by a passion for radio and television, which would later shape his career. After serving in the U.S. Navy during World War II, he pursued a career in broadcasting, eventually finding his calling in television comedy.
